God’s Promise for the Weary and Heavy Burdened
In my personal journey, I've found immense comfort and renewed strength from reflecting on Matthew 11:28, where Jesus says, "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est." This verse acts as a powerful reminder that no matter the struggles or overwhelming feelings we face—be it anxiety, fatigue, or the heavy burdens of life—we are not alone. Turning to God’s word and embracing His peace can bring deep restoration to both mind and spirit. When life feels overwhelming, I’ve learned to pause and meditate on these words, allowing myself to surrender my worries and invite God’s rest into my heart. It’s not just about physical rest, but a soulful, transformative peace that quiets anxious thoughts and renews hope. This restful promise is especially meaningful during times of uncertainty or emotional stress. Moreover, integrating this truth into daily life can include practices like prayer, reading scripture, or simply quiet reflection on God’s love. Such habits help build resilience and remind us that God’s rest isn’t a one-time event but an ongoing refuge amidst life’s storms.
